HomeMy Public PortalAbout1996-09-19 Budget Hearing15 COUNCIL MINUTES BUDGET HEARING - SEPTEMBER 19, 1996 A Budget Hearing meeting of the Bal Harbour Village Council was held on Thursday, September 19, 1996, in the Council Chamber at Bal Harbour village Hall. The meeting was called to order by Mayor Spiegel at 5:16 p.m. The roll was called and those present were: Mayor Estelle Spiegel Assistant Mayor Matthew B. Blank Councilman James E. Boggess Councilman Andrew R. Hirschl Also present: Alfred J. Treppeda, Village Manager Jeanette Horton, Village Clerk John Walker, Finance Director Richard J. Weiss, Village Attorney Absent: Councilman Sol M. Taplin As a quorum was determined to be present, the meeting commenced. 2. Announcement: Mayor Spiegel announced that Bal Harbour Village Rolled -Back Millage Rate is 3.30 Mills, the proposed Millage Rate is 3.50 Mills, which exceeds the Rolled -Back Rate by 6.06 percent. 3. Discussion of Proposed Tax Minium Rate: Mr. Treppeda explained the proposed millage rate for the upcoming fiscal year is 3.50 mills. He further explained the Village has the third lowest millage rate in the county. 4. Discussion of Proposed Budgets: Mayor Spiegel opened a Public Hearing for comments. There being none, Mayor Spiegel closed the Public Hearing. 5. Resolution - Adoption of Millage Rate: A resolution adopting the millage rate was read, by title, by the Village Clerk. Mayor Spiegel then proceeded to open the Public Hearing for comments. There being none, Mayor Spiegel closed the Public Hearing. A motion was offered by Councilman Boggess and seconded by Assistant Mayor Blank to adopt this resolution. The motion carried with the vote as follows: Mayor Spiegel aye; Assistant Mayor Blank aye; Councilman Boggess aye; Councilman Hirschl aye; Councilman Taplin absent, thus becoming RESOLUTION NO. 539 RESOLUTION OF BAL HARBOUR VILLAGE ADOPTING A FINAL MILLAGE RATE FOR FISCAL YEAR 1996/97; PROVIDING FOR AN EFFECTIVE DATE. 16 6. Ordinance/Public Hearings - Adoption of Proposed Budgets: General Fund An ordinance adopting the General Fund Budget for Fiscal Year 1996/97 was read, by title, by the Village Clerk. Mayor Spiegel then proceeded to open the Public Hearing for comments. There being none, Mayor Spiegel closed the Public Hearing. A motion was offered by Councilman Hirschl and seconded by Councilman Boggess to enact this ordinance. The motion carried with the vote as follows: Mayor Spiegel aye; Assistant Mayor Blank aye; Councilman Boggess aye; Councilman Hirschl aye; Councilman Taplin absent, thus becoming ORDINANCE NO. 413 ORDINANCE OF BAL HARBOUR VILLAGE ADOPTING A BUDGET FOR THE PERIOD OF OCTOBER 1, 1996 TO SEPTEMBER 30, 1997, IN THE AMOUNT OF $5,101,948; AUTHORIZING EXPENDITURES; ESTABLISHING AN EFFECTIVE DATE. Water Fund An ordinance adopting the Water Department Budget for Fiscal Year 1996/97 was read, by title, by the Village Clerk. Mayor Spiegel then proceeded to open the Public Hearing for comments. There being none, Mayor Spiegel closed the Public Hearing. A motion was offered by Assistant Mayor Blank and seconded by Councilman Boggess to enact this ordinance. The motion carried with the vote as follows; Mayor Spiegel aye; Assistant Mayor Blank aye; Councilman Boggess aye; Councilman Hirschl aye; Councilman Taplin absent, thus becoming ORDINANCE NO. 414 ORDINANCE OF BAL HARBOUR VILLAGE ADOPTING A BUDGET FOR THE WATER DEPARTMENT FOR THE PERIOD OF OCTOBER 1, 1996 TO SEPTEMBER 30, 1997, IN THE AMOUNT OF $944,048; AUTHORIZING EXPENDITURES; ESTABLISHING AN EFFECTIVE DATE. Sanitary Sewer Fund An ordinance adopting the Sanitary Sewer Department Budget for the Fiscal Year 1996/97 was read, by title, by the Village clerk. Mayor Spiegel then proceeded to open the Public Hearing for comments. There being none, Mayor Spiegel closed the Public Hearing. A motion was offered by Councilman Hirschl an seconded by Assistant Mayor Blank to enact this ordinance. The motion carried with the vote as follows: Mayor Spiegel aye; Assistant Mayor Blank aye; Councilman Boggess aye; Councilman Hirschl aye; Councilman Taplin absent, thus becoming Budget Hearing 09/19/96 2 1: ORDINANCE NO. 415 ORDINANCE OF BAL HARBOUR VILLAGE ADOPTING A BUDGET FOR THE SANITARY SEWER DEPARTMENT FOR THE PERIOD OF OCTOBER 1, 1996 TO SEPTEMBER 30, 1997, IN THE AMOUNT OF $1,135,216; AUTHORIZING EXPENDITURES, ESTABLISHING AN EFFECTIVE DATE. Department of Tourism An ordinance adopting the Department of Tourism Budget for Fiscal year 1996/97 was read, by title, by the Village Clerk. Mayor Spiegel then proceeded to open the Public Hearing for comments. There being none, Mayor Spiegel closed the Public Hearing. A motion was offered by Councilman Boggess and seconded by Assistant Mayor Blank to enact this ordinance. The motion carried with the vote as follows: Mayor Spiegel aye; Assistant Mayor Blank aye; Councilman Boggess aye; Councilman Hirschl aye; Councilman Taplin absent, thus becoming ORDINANCE NO. 416 ORDINANCE OF BAL HARBOUR VILLAGE ADOPTING A BUDGET FOR THE PERIOD OF OCTOBER 1, 1996 TO SEPTEMBER 30, 1997, IN THE AMOUNT OF $1,598,439; AUTHORIZING EXPENDITURES, ESTABLISHING AN EFFECTIVE DATE. 7.
